Ich verzweifle... Mein Apache für Windows 2.2.4 unter Vista 32 Ultimate führt meine Perl-Scripts nicht aus sondern bringt den Dialog
"Möchten Sie diese Datei öffnen oder speichern"
Wie kann ich dieses Problem lösen?
Besten Dank für Eure Hilfe!
Einträge in der HTTPD.CONF:
LoadModule cgi_module modules/mod_cgi.so
..
ScriptInterpreterSource Registry
..
ScriptAlias /cgi-bin/ "E:/Apache/localhost/cgi-bin/"
<IfModule mime_module>
...
AddHandler cgi-script .cgi .pl
...
</IfModule>
<Directory "E:/Apache/localhost/cgi-bin">
AllowOverride None
Options Indexes FollowSymLinks ExecCGI
Order allow,deny
Allow from all
AddHandler cgi-script .cgi .pl
</Directory>
In der Registry habe ich folgende Einträge:
[HKEY_CLASSES_ROOT\*\shell\ExecCGI\Command]
@="C:\\program files\\perl\\bin\\perl.exe %1"
[HKEY_CLASSES_ROOT\.pl\Shell\ExecCGI\Command]
@="C:\\program files\\perl\\bin\\perl.exe %1"